People really do talk out of their bums when it comes to Rooney, I always hear the "has been rubbish for the past 2-3 years" argument. It''s utter tosh.

Apparently he was "very poor" last season but he still scored 12 goals and made 10 assists in 22 premier league starts and 5 sub appearances. He contributed at least a goal every 90 minutes despite playing all over the pitch (basically never as a CF) and suffering some bad injuries.

Personally I think the hate is more to do with people not liking him as a person (which is kind of understandable), not to mention the amount of money he earns and the way he earnt that extortionate contract a few years ago
